ICICI Bank launches ‘Mine’, a banking stack for millennials

ICICI, bank, India, MNC, finance, card, banking, Mine, stack, millennialICICI Bank today announced the launch of a comprehensive banking programme for Indian millennial customers, in the age bracket of 18 years to 35 years. Inspired by ‘Millennial Network’, the proposition is called ‘ICICI Bank Mine’ and offers an instant savings account, a feature-driven iMobile application that offers investment guidance, curated credit and debit cards, instant personal loans & overdrafts, and also an experiential branch with a social engagement space.

The ICICI Bank branch with experiential engagement area will at times will serve as the venue for ‘Mine Live’, a platform that hosts specially curated virtual events in the form of workshops, panel discussions, talent shows on travel, food, health and entertainment. The first experiential branch for millennials has been opened at the Manyata Tech Park in Bengaluru.

The bank offers its investment option service in association with Sqrrl, a mutual fund investment FinTech.

Anup Bagchi, Executive Director, ICICI Bank said, “Our country is uniquely poised for a demographic dividend in the coming years with millions of youth expected to join the workforce. We estimate that the country has around 40 million progressive young millennials, who would contribute significantly to the economy and banking in the years to come. Our extensive research shows that millennial customers want banking to be simple, digitally enabled and customised. Based on these insights, we have created ‘ICICI Bank Mine’, the country’s first full banking stack for millennials. It offers a mobile first, highly personalised and experiential led banking experience to them. We have noticed that, while the millennial customers want ‘digital first’, they don’t want a ‘digital only’ bank. This has led us to introduce a new format experiential branch suited to the lifestyle of millennials.

‘ICICI Bank Mine’ also offers investment guidance to customers through a completely user experience focused iMobile application. For this, we have integrated the investment platform of Sqrrl, a leading fintech in the investment space, with our mobile application iMobile, to guide customers to invest easily and in a tech-savvy way. We intend to continue to integrate relevant fintech offerings in the iMobile app for our millennial customers. We believe that ‘ICICI Bank Mine’ offers millennial customers a 360-degree holistic and most comprehensive proposition in a single place across their life stages.”

Any millennial who is aged up to 35 years can apply digitally for an ‘ICICI Bank Mine’ account from November 6, 2020.
